Why is Rajendra Chola regarded as ‘Gangaikonda’ or the conqueror of Ganga?

Answer:

He was a very powerful king and was one of the most famous rulers of southern India. Rajendra chola is regarded as Gangaikonda or the conquer of Ganga because he had conquered places up to the River Ganga.
